The Science Behind Sugar’s Action on Wounds

The primary mechanism by which concentrated sugar affects a wound environment is hyperosmolarity, meaning the sugar creates a solution with a high concentration of dissolved particles. This high concentration draws moisture out of the surrounding tissue and, more importantly, out of bacterial cells. Pathogenic microbes are inhibited because their cellular processes depend on water activity, and the sugar’s hygroscopic nature effectively dehydrates them.

This withdrawal of water from bacterial cells is called plasmolysis, which suppresses microbial growth and helps control infection. The high-sugar concentration also reduces local swelling by drawing excess fluid from the wound bed, aiding in reducing edema. The presence of sugar may slightly lower the wound’s pH to around 5.0, creating a mildly acidic environment less favorable for most bacteria. Beyond its antimicrobial action, the sugar acts as a nutrient source that can stimulate local cells, potentially aiding in new tissue formation and promoting granulation.

Historical Use and Current Clinical Status

The use of sugar-based substances for wound treatment extends back to ancient civilizations. Records from the Mesopotamians and ancient Egyptians describe using honey, a substance rich in sugars, to dress wounds as far back as 4,000 years ago. The early modern use of granulated sucrose for wound cleansing was documented in the late 17th century. This historical context demonstrates a recognition of sugar’s ability to manage certain types of injuries.

Despite this history, household granulated table sugar is not a standard or recommended practice in mainstream clinical medicine today. Specialized, medical-grade honey is sometimes employed in controlled clinical settings, particularly for chronic or infected wounds, but it is sterilized and processed to meet strict medical standards. Granular sucrose is occasionally used in monitored clinical trials or in resource-limited settings, and some countries utilize a commercially manufactured sugar-povidone-iodine paste for wound care. These are specialized applications that contrast sharply with the self-application of unsterilized kitchen sugar.

Safety Considerations and Potential Risks

The most significant danger in using household sugar on a wound is the high risk of introducing contamination from the product itself. Unlike medical-grade treatments, unsterilized table sugar can harbor various microorganisms, including bacteria, fungal spores, and yeast, which may be transferred directly into an open wound and cause a serious infection. Furthermore, the sugar may contain physical debris or anti-caking agents that are not intended for use in biological tissues.

Self-treating with sugar also carries the substantial risk of delaying professional medical intervention for a serious injury or infection. A person may mistakenly believe the wound is improving while a deeper infection continues to progress underneath the sugar dressing. For individuals with diabetes, the practice presents specific challenges, even though some studies have investigated sugar use on diabetic ulcers. A high concentration of glucose in the wound bed can potentially impair the natural healing mechanisms of diabetic tissue by promoting a state of chronic inflammation. The application of a non-sterile, unmonitored substance introduces a danger that outweighs any potential benefit, especially when the wound’s condition is not properly assessed.

Recommended Standard Wound Care Practices

For safe and effective home care of minor cuts and abrasions, evidence-based practices should be followed. The initial step involves gently cleaning the wound with clean water or a saline solution to remove any visible dirt or debris. Once cleaned, the wound should be assessed for signs of deeper injury or foreign objects that may require professional attention.

Following cleansing, the wound should be covered with a sterile dressing to protect it and maintain a moist healing balance. Over-the-counter antibiotic ointments can be used, but the primary focus is on proper wound dressing and hygiene. Seek immediate medical attention if the wound is deep, bleeding heavily, or shows signs of infection, such as increasing redness, warmth, swelling, or purulent drainage.
